T.With the awards ceremony scheduled for November 16th, the US National Book Foundation today (September 14th) began announcing the long list for the 2021 National Book Awards. In three days he parses the announcements across five categories, as the program likes.
Finalists (shortlisted entries) will be named on October 4th.
The longlist provided to members of the news media today is from the National Book Awards for Youth Literature.
This is the first of five categories. Future plans:

Collectively, the authors and illustrators of this list have been awarded the Newbery Medal of Honor. Walter Honor. Honor of Prinz. Coretta Scott King Book Award. Ezra Jack Keats Award. Kirkus Prize for Young Readers Literature. Glyph Comics Awards. Stonewall Book Awards. and an Emmy Award.
Publishers have submitted a total of 296 books for the 2022 Youth Literature Division.
This time the judge is Becky Albertali, Joseph Bruchuk, Megan Dietche Goel, Jewel Parker Rose (Chair), Lilium Rivera.
